INDONESIAN GOVT PREPARING RESERVE FUNDS TO FACE EL NINO'S IMPACT.
July 29, 2009... JAKARTA, July 29 Asia Pulse - The Indonesian government is preparing reserve funds of Rp1 trillion to Rp2 trillion (US$100 million to US$200 million) for efforts to cushion the impact of El Nino on the country`s agriculture in 2010, a minister said.
